Current look of the unpainted Iron Rangers located throughout our state forests and parks system.
In 2003, artist and Moore State Park Friends Group member Marjorie Greenberg asked if she could paint the park's Iron Ranger. Here is the tree stump design Marjorie submitted.
Her design was accepted. Marjorie painted the Iron Ranger as a pilot project to see how the paint would stand up to the New England weather.
The paint on the Iron Ranger has withstood the test of time. It’s still beautiful and annual donations have more than doubled since it was painted.
DCR would like to enhance the look of all the Iron Rangers. DCR is seeking artists to paint these Iron Rangers that receive financial contributions to benefit our state forests and parks system.
